About 2-butan-2-yl-3-ethyl-4-methyloxolane
2-butan-2-yl-3-ethyl-4-methyloxolane (PubChem CID 59936247) has the molecular formula C11H22O
and a molecular weight of 170.30 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-butan-2-yl-3-ethyl-4-methyloxolane.
